Syria's grand mufti meets with chairman of Scotland archbishop for cooperation among religions
Syria-UK, Religion, 3/8/2003
Syria's Grand Mufti, Sheikh, Ahmad Kitaro, received in Damascus yesterday Chairman of Scotland archbishop, Fenli Macdonald and an accompanying delegation.
Talks during the meeting dealt with the importance of cooperation among individuals of the heavenly messages for protecting man and ensuring peace and good life for all individuals.
Kiftaro noted "the Israeli brutal massacres in the Palestinian territories and the US declaration of an open and comprehensive war to include the Arab and Islamic regions to serve the interest of the Zionist purposes."
For his part, Macdonald asserted opposition of people in the West to the US possible war on Iraq. He indicated that the huge demonstrations staged with the participation of deferent classes of the European society to express opposition to war.
He praised Syria's social life which is distinguished by fraternity and tolerance.
